Main Event Final Table: 4th place, Tom Gleason $48,440

$1,500 + $150 Seminole Hard Rock “Rock ‘n’ Poker Open” Main Event

Blinds: 25k/50k/5k ante

Tom Gleason was never able to recover from the loss to Tyler Stafman and moved all-in twice after a Matt Waxman raise. The final time Waxman had a hand to call it down.

Waxman quickly called the shove with KhKc and Gleason needed help with AdJc. He picked up an unlikely gutshot draw on the QsTc3s flop. There was no luck on the Qh turn or Th river and Tom Gleason dropped quickly in 4th place for $48,440.
